Tarot Card Symbols of Self-Worth


**The Empress**: The highest symbol of abundance and self-acceptance—the Empress doesn't become abundant through striving; abundance is the nature of her existence. **The Sun**: Your radiance is real and deserves to be seen—let yourself be fully illuminated; don't make yourself smaller. **Strength**: Inner self-worth comes from gentle self-knowledge, not from conquering external things to confirm your value.

**The Devil**: Addiction to external validation—when self-worth depends entirely on others' opinions or external achievement, that's a Devil-like bondage. **Nine of Swords**: The nights of self-criticism—those late-night anxious voices asking "am I really good enough?" **Three of Cups**: Your existence brings joy to those around you—this is a direct confirmation of self-worth.

Self-Worth Tarot Spread (5 Cards)


**Card 1: What is my true inner worth?** (Let the cards tell you, bypassing your self-criticism); **Card 2: What belief or experience has made me doubt my own value?**; **Card 3: What aspect of myself do I most underestimate?**; **Card 4: How does my existence bring value to others?** (External confirmation, but not dependency); **Card 5: What can I do to more deeply accept and embody my inner worth?**

After this spread, look at Cards 1 and 3 together—that is tarot's core message to you about your self-worth. Write it down and put it somewhere you'll see every day as a reminder of your true value.
